Concentrated cassis, black cherries and some herbaceousness on the nose and palate. A cold, wet Winter in 2009 allowed for the lovely, even budding of the vineyards during Spring, and the warm, sunny days that followed in Summer resulted in great flavour and colour development in the berries. Full fruit flavours and soft tannins, together with good aromatics and ideal acidity, made 2010 an excellent vintage.
